An exploration of individual factors which impact on stalking attitudes

17 May 2017

The study aims to discover whether there are stable individual differences between people that predict pro-stalking attitudes. In particular, this study is investigating the validity of The Dark Triad, mating effort, “Facebook Stalking” of ex-intimates, and Tinder use motivations in predicting pro-stalking attitudes. It also aims to investigate the incremental value of these four factors.
